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
72 76057713 3804045 55628197 033413660
64 75362412823
64 75362412823
307424 745538181 9466
All about undefined
Interested in learning more?
64 75362412823
307424 745538181 9466
See more
1730 05423213 7159763705
245204952 21263 6291
See more
81590 245057 13006287
03 086462743 3564
See more